Just finished the last War Doctor volume, "Casualties of War." I'd been putting it off for a few days, but finally had a free Saturday to sit down and listen. Didn't think I'd listen to it all in one day, but I did. My thoughts:
Pretty Lies — A decent story that's exciting all the way through. It's probably the most action packed of the three, and it kept me the most on my toes. It actually had me feeling bad for certain characters and the citizens of the setting, which was a Dalek-attacked town.
The Lady of Obsidian — Leela's back! We find out what happened to her during the war, and her reunion with the Doctor is a fitting one. Any part of the story not focused on Leela, though, was a bit dull.
The Enigma Dimension — the Daleks get serious, and we get a lot of Leela and Cardinal Ollistra. The Doctor does something that shocks me towards the end, though why it shocks me I do not know; it really hits home what he's willing to do to end the war, and although I'm already fully aware of the lengths that he'll go to, I'm still, for some reason surprised by it. Perhaps I cannot accept that this man is not the Doctor.

I didn't realize how much I enjoyed this series until I was aware that I would get no more of it. The Doctor's final lines in the last story make it even worse, since it ended on such a sad note. But he was the Doctor — and John Hurt made a fine Doctor — whether he liked it or not.

May Hurt rest in peace.

>>79805376
>Only that first adventure in the Highlands
That's what they say in The War Games.

But in the season 6b stories—including The Two Doctors—he clearly remembers both Victoria and the Time Lords, and the only way that can be true is if the memory wipe didn't take, or got undone.

In the late 80s, in the DWM comic where he dies, they explain that Time Lords don't understand human brains nearly as well as they think they do, so some simple tricks the Doctor taught him were enough to keep pretty much everything.
